Kyogre, Groudon, Rayquaza and Deoxys are all Shiny Locked. Unless you have a shiny one of those 4 legendaries I just stated from a previous game or like to spend over 2 hours searching on GTS or Wonder Trade, you will not be able to get one.
Shiny kyogre is shiny-locked which means it can't be shiny. As for the other three, shiny phione might be possible with a bloody lucky breed, but don't quote me on that and as for mythical Pokemon I don't think you can shiny manaphy or arecus without it being hacked.
